Edward Williams this cause being upon ejectment and continued Liber M M
agt to this day the pit not appeareing to make further
Philip Shapleigh prosecution therein Ordered a non suite be
awarded agt him and that the deft recover against
him the full quantity of pounds of tobacco for his
costs and charges in this behalfe laid Out and expended and the
plaintiff have no benefitt of his writt.

John Balley John Russell of Calvert County upon the Clifts planter
agt was attached to answer unto John Balley of St Maries
John Russell County Merchant in an action of trespas upon the
case.
And whereupon the said John Bailey by Thomas Bland his At
torny complaineth that whereas the said John Bailey was the 5th day
of July 1669 at Petuxent River in the County of Calvert put in Pos
session by Mr Christopher Rousby the Sheriff of the said County
of a certaine quantity of cattle and horses amongst which was a
young horse light Bay which at that time was Somewhat more than
One yeare Old and the said Bailey being so possessed left the said
